France, Pendule Religieuse, ebonized case with fine moldings and Boulle work on gilt ball feet, the red tortoise shell inlaid with scroll sawn, engraved brass, and with pewter stringing, the corners with gilt bronze, stop fluted, Corinthian pilasters, removable caddy top with gilt balustrade and eight flame finials, red velvet covered dial with Roman numeral pewter chapter ring, above a plaque engraved "Jerome Martinet a Paris", pierced and engraved brass hands, spring powered, 8 days, time and strike movement with Brocot escapement, mid 19th century, case with some earlier components case with restoration, minor losses to tortoise shell and inlay, dirty, four finials replaced, velvet on dial torn, minute hand repaired, ticks and strikes, 26 1/2"h x 15 1/2"w
